"Twelve flower goddesses" appear at a university in Chongqing

CHONGQING (CQNEWS) -- Peony, pomegranate, plum blossom... On April 11, at the 3rd National Culture Festival held by Chongqing Metropolitan College of Science and Technology, 12 "flower goddesses" dressed in Hanfu gracefully appeared to celebrate the "Flower Festival".
It is reported that this National Cultural Festival, themed by" Intangible Cultural Heritage of Flower, Feast of National Culture", combined with the cultural elements of the traditional Chinese festival "Flower Festival", has designed four major theme areas.

At the scene, "twelve flower goddesses" dressed in Hanfu appeared, walking gracefully with their clothes fluttering, making the audience feel as if they traveled to ancient times and were among flowers. In addition, there were many folk games such as cuju, pitch pot, archery, and peg-top, allowing students to easily access the ancient folk recreation; Intangible cultural heritage programs such as head-pinned flowers making, twined flowers making, ancient paper-making, round silk fan with pressed flowers, and lantern making allow students to experience the unique charm of traditional handicrafts at close range.
Gong Yumeng, Secretary of the Youth League Branch of the School of Economics and Management at Chongqing Metropolitan College of Science and Technology, told the reporter that the School of Economics and Management has held the National Culture Festival for three consecutive years. Through the activities in the first two years, it is found that students are very fond of the national culture. In her view, the youth of the new era should spread and present these excellent traditional cultures in a diversified and multi-angle manner rather than keeping them in their own hands and corresponding carriers, so as to attract more people to devote themselves to the cause of cultural inheritance.
"The Flower Festival is a romantic festival that celebrates the birthday of flowers. Activities are held such as spring outings and flower enjoying, head-pinned flowers making and twined flowers making, and other special activities. We hope that the Flower Festival, an excellent traditional festival will be rejuvenated.” Gong Yumeng also hoped that this activity will allow students to know more about traditional festivals, making them more familiar with, love and carry forward traditional Chinese culture.
